Low consumption light bulbs Web28 aug. 2024 · Does current get used up in a light bulb? The brightness of the light bulbs is the same, meaning current does not get used up in the first light bulb and what’s left makes it to the second. Also, the more bulbs are added in series the dimmer they ALL get. That means a light bulb represents an obstacle to the flow of charges – the current.

Signs use light bulbs in many ways: as simple illumination, to backlight sign lettering, or as … WebWhat Are Halogen Light Bulbs Commonly Used For? Halogen bulbs can produce brighter white light while using less energy than their predecessors. They can be tiny, but they do get quite hot. Common uses for halogen bulbs are: Outdoor and indoor floodlights Car headlights Pendant lights Track lighting Projectors

WebThe light bulb creates light when electrical current passes through the metal filament wire, heating it to a high temperature until it glows. The hot filament is protected from air by a glass bulb that is filled with inert gas. … Web10 feb. 2024 · The incandescent light bulb, using a filament inside a glass bulb, has a complex history. Belgian inventor Marcellin Jobard experimented with carbon filaments in vacuum tubes as early as 1838 and, before Thomas Edison examined the technology, other inventors were hard at work on their own devices.

Web10 jul. 2024 · In incandescent light bulbs, the light wattage will directly affect the light intensity. The higher the wattage, the higher the light intensity. For example, a 100-watt incandescent bulb will produce about 1700-1800 lumens. Notably, a 32-watt CFL or a 15-watt LED is the equivalent of 100-watt incandescent bulbs.

A light bulb is able to … newtothenavy redditWeb8 jun. 2024 · Generally, light bulbs use between 2 and 100 watts (W) of electricity, depending on the size and type. Traditional incandescent bulbs use 25 to 100 W, and LED bulbs use 2 to 18 W. Light bulbs draw around 110 volts and usually less than 1 amp.
